Why This Role Matters:
The Admissions Coordinator plays a key role in ensuring that every patient enters Bryn Mawr Rehabilitation Hospital safely, appropriately, and with all necessary clinical and logistical details in place. By gathering and verifying medical, demographic, financial, and social information, this role supports accurate admission decisions and prepares the care team for each patient’s needs. The coordinator serves as the central point of communication—managing referrals, bed placement, census updates, and coordination with physicians, nursing units, insurance representatives, and families. Their work maintains patient flow, supports clinical readiness, and ensures a smooth, informed transition into inpatient rehabilitation.
